5 What is RFID Power Stored data Radio Frequency IDentification is detection of tagged objects from a remote transponder (tag) including an antenna and a microchip transceiver (IC) using a local querying system (reader or interrogator)

11 Inductive Coupling Backscatter N Reader TAG Reader TAG S Near field (LF, HF): inductive coupling of tag to magnetic field circulating around antenna (like a transformer) Varying magnetic flux induces current in tag. Modulate tag load to communicate with reader field energy decreases proportionally to 1/R 3 (to first order) Far field (UHF, microwave): backscatter. Modulate back scatter by changing antenna impedance Field energy decreases proportionally to 1/R Boundry between near and far field: R = wavelength/2 pi so, once have reached far field, lower frequencies will have lost significantly more energy than high frequencies Absorption by non-conductive materials significant problem for microwave frequencies Source of data: Introduction to RFID CAENRFID an IIT Corporation

22 RFID/Sensor Module Integration Antenna Demodulation Digital Data Digital Logic & MODEM Voltage Multiplier Power EEPROM ADC Modulation Digital data Sensor Ultimate goal: All printed RFID tag (antenna, IC, battery, and sensor) on paper Operating frequency: UHF (900 MHz), RF (2.45 GHz), potentially up to 60 GHz Suggested Module integration: Printed battery on surface Printable sensor technology on surface Surface mounted IC Operation modes Passive Tags: Antenna uses EM power from reader. Semi-Passive Tags: IC uses EM power distribution Sensor uses battery Increased node s lifetime Active tag: IC and sensor utilize battery Increased data range (>100 ft compared to 30 ft in semi-passive) Excellent for harsh environments for their improved S/N

26 Advantages of UHF for Sensing Free Spectrum: US: MHz, MHz Europe: MHz At UHF, long read distances achievable compared to LF and HF Better penetration through objects than higher frequencies Higher data rates achievable Better sensing resolution
